BCP Council (Poole Area): Matt Annen is delighted to confirm that planning permission has been granted for the extension and modernisation of two beachfront cafes in Poole for Rockwater.

Each proposal faced a number of differing planning hurdles which we had to overcome. The Sandbanks site is in close proximity to a Site of Nature Conservation Interest (SNCI) which is recognised as an important habitat for rare reptiles as well as scarce annual plant species. Branksome Chine Cafe is situated within a conservation area and is a Locally Listed Building. However, they both shared one common goal – enhancing the Council’s tourism offer which is a key strategic objective for the area as a whole given that both sites are located adjacent to award-winning Blue Flag beaches and tourism is incredibly important to the wider BCP economy.

To reinforce this the BCP Destination and Culture Services, commented the following on the Sandbanks application: “The proposal features a new pergola, new patio area and a new outdoor deck which
will support animation of the seafront and encourage footfall. The newly designed café will be a positive asset to the destination and tourism offer and Tourism would therefore have no objections to this application”
.

Building works are underway on Branksome Chine cafe and construction is due to start in the next month or so on the Sandbanks cafe site. We look forward to visiting both in the future.
